    They make insane amounts of REAL money.They earn so much money that even if they need to reobtain an account every day they are in the plus.
    Why do you think you have a limited number of characters you can make by week? Because RMTs hoarded money by repeating a handfull of low level quests, ditching the money somewhere delete all low levels and start anew.

    Oh this "When people stop buying gil".
    There ALWAYS will be people that are willing to pay real money for digital "swag" (boy do I hate this word).
    I could understand why some people buy gil in FFXI or Gold in WoW, I never would do it though.

    I don't understand the need to buy gil in FFXIV. Unless you are super clumsy mosts crafts will earn you more gil than you spend. That + Dailies and normal dungeons give you good gil rewards. Gil bought Armor is 95% of the time worse than any drop
